Rezerwat Dwunastak
Rezerwat Dwunastak is a nature reserve in Gmina Miłosław, Września County, Wielkopolskie. Rezerwat Dwunastak is situated nearby to the hamlet Leśnictwo Sarnice, as well as near Czeszewo-Budy.Places of Interest
Highlights include Saint Nicholas church in Czeszewo and Pavillon de chasse in Bugaj.

Miłosław
Town
Photo: Takasamarasa, CC BY-SA 3.0 pl.
Miłosław is a town in Września County, Greater Poland Voivodeship, Poland, with 3,627 inhabitants.
